I've got one and while it works decently (well, not anymore), it's not that remarkable. It tends to get caught in things like curtains, rugs, and furniture, which causes it to cry to be set free. Now something's wrong with it and it won't run for more than 3 seconds. It probably needs a new battery but I was never happy enough with it to look into fixing it which is telling. We mostly got it to keep hardfloors clean because sweeping sucks, but we still had to sweep after it. If you let it run a cycle daily, it will probably do a decent job for you, but don't set your expectations too high.
